Basic Calculator
This free online calculator works just like a standard handheld calculator and includes full memory functionality. You can perform basic math calculations such as addition, subtraction, multiplication, and division directly in your browser.
In addition to standard arithmetic, the calculator supports advanced functions including square root, percentages, pi (π), exponents, powers, and rounding (to whole numbers or two decimals). It also allows repeating operations and includes higher-power and root calculations, as well as easy-to-use memory buttons (MC, MR, M+, M−) and clear options (AC and CE). Detailed instructions for using each function on this calculator are provided below.
You can operate the calculator using your mouse, keyboard, number pad, or by touch on supported devices, making it convenient for desktop, laptop, tablet, and mobile users.

How to Use the Calculator Memory
The calculator’s memory always starts at 0. You can store and update values using the M+, M-, MR, and MC keys:
M+ (Memory Plus) – Adds the number currently shown on the display to the value stored in memory.
M- (Memory Minus) – Subtracts the displayed number from the memory value.
MR (Memory Recall) – Shows the current number stored in memory on the display.
MC (Memory Clear) – Resets the calculator’s memory back to zero.
Use these buttons when you want to keep track of running totals without writing anything down.
For clearing the screen:
AC (All Clear) fully resets the calculator and removes your entire calculation.
CE (Clear Entry) removes only the most recent number you typed, without deleting the rest of your equation.
If the AC button isn’t visible, press CE once and the button will switch back to AC, allowing you to completely clear the calculator.
